摘 要:为了解国产高强度结构钢材的生产情况,获得国产高强度结构钢材的材性参数,对目前国内主要钢铁企业生产的Q500,Q550和Q690结构钢材进行了调研。调研的内容主要为材料的力学性能。同时开展了独立的材性试验,作为对调研收集数据的验证和补充。对收集到的数据分企业进行了统计分析,了解每一家企业的生产情况,从而对国产高强度结构钢材生产情况有一个全面的认识。在此基础上,采用数理统计的方法对独立试验的数据和调研收集的数据进行了综合分析,得到了不同钢材牌号不同厚度分组材料屈服强度的统计参数,得到的材性参数将作为下一步计算高强钢构件抗力分项系数的基础,为《高强钢结构设计规程》的编制提供研究依据。In order to investigate the production status of domestic high-strength structural steels and obtain the parametersof material properties, QS00, Q550 and Q690 steels produced by major steel manufacturers in China have been studied.The main research content contains the data of mechanical properties. Meanwhile, the independent material test was carriedout, which can be viewed as the verification and supplement of the collected data. The collected data which were firstlyclassified by different manufacturers were analyzed by statistical method to investigate the production status of eachmanufacturer, which help us to have a full picture of the production status of high-strength structural steels in China. Onthis basis, the collected and independent test data were classified by different grades and thicknesses. On this basis, thecollected and independent test data were analyzed by the mathematical statistics method. The statistical parameters of yieldstrength which were classified by different grades and thicknesses were obtained, which would be used for calculating thepartial factors for resistance of high-strength steels and give practical suggestions to Specification for design of high strengthsteel structures of China.
